admin管理员组

文章数量:1604652

极光谷歌版本SDK : 资源下载 - 极光文档

下载好以后解压出来,找到libs下的两个jar文件

我们项目中使用的jpush-react-native 和 jcore-react-native,所以解压以后将上图中的那两jar文件,分别放到node_modules/jpush-react-native/android/libs,以及node_modules/jpush-react-native/android/libs下,删掉以前原有的jar 文件

我替换这些jar文件之前跟极光技术问了N次,讲实话,极光技术人员回答问题模棱两可,意思真的全靠自己猜。你问好几个问题,他挑一个回复,然后特简短一句话。前一天问必须删了这俩node_modules 里安的包?回答:是,不然报错,只能手动集成sdk,今天我说那么操作会影响ios,又开始变化回答,回答慢可以理解,但是希望极光的技术人员可以对自己家的技术了解的更透彻,搜了两天,从好多地方看到,呼吁极光直接出谷歌版本的集成在npm的包里,2020年开始看到,现在都没人回那些消息(这段是吐槽,可以跳过不看

​​​​​​​解压后从libs 文件中复制jar文件,对应替换jpush-react-native 和jcore-react-native中的jar文件 以及 res 文件中的各个文件

此处以jpush-react-native为例

将android/libs文件下的jar换成SDK解析出的jar(上边有图)

src/main/res文件对比解析出的文件没有的文件补上,有的文件替换即可(上边有图)

将下边圈起来的对应换项目里就OK了

Android studio build,如果有问题,或者提示某些不存在,查找确认修改这些报错处

然后我们就通过了审核了,✿✿ヽ(°▽°)ノ✿

本文标签: 极光没过版本SDKGoogle